| #include <arch/x86.h> |
| #include <arch/x86/mmu.h> |
| #include <err.h> |
| #include <kernel/mutex.h> |
| |
| #define UART_REGISTER_THR 0 /* WO Transmit Holding Register */ |
| #define UART_REGISTER_LSR 5 /* R/W Line Status Register */ |
| |
| typedef union { |
| struct { |
| uint8_t dr : 1; |
| uint8_t oe : 1; |
| uint8_t pe : 1; |
| uint8_t fe : 1; |
| uint8_t bi : 1; |
| uint8_t thre : 1; |
| uint8_t temt : 1; |
| uint8_t fifoe : 1; |
| } bits; |
| uint8_t data; |
| } uart_lsr_t; |
| |
| static spin_lock_t dputc_spin_lock = 0; |
| |
| static uint8_t serial_io_get_reg(uint64_t base_addr, uint32_t reg_id) { |
| return inp((uint16_t)base_addr + (uint16_t)reg_id); |
| } |
| |
| static void serial_io_set_reg(uint64_t base_addr, |
| uint32_t reg_id, |
| uint8_t val) { |
| outp((uint16_t)base_addr + (uint16_t)reg_id, val); |
| } |
| |
| static void uart_putc(char c) { |
| uart_lsr_t lsr; |
| |
| do { |
| lsr.data = serial_io_get_reg(TARGET_SERIAL_IO_BASE, UART_REGISTER_LSR); |
| } while (!lsr.bits.thre); |
| |
| serial_io_set_reg(TARGET_SERIAL_IO_BASE, UART_REGISTER_THR, c); |
| } |
| |
| void platform_dputc(char c) { |
| spin_lock_saved_state_t state; |
| spin_lock_save(&dputc_spin_lock, &state, SPIN_LOCK_FLAG_INTERRUPTS); |
| uart_putc(c); |
| spin_unlock_restore(&dputc_spin_lock, state, SPIN_LOCK_FLAG_INTERRUPTS); |
| } |
| |
| /* Do not accept any input */ |
| int platform_dgetc(char* c, bool wait) { |
| return ERR_NOT_SUPPORTED; |
| } |
